The Writer
Melville Shavelson contributed to the screenplay for the following films:The Princess and the Pirate (1944)
Wonder Man (1945)
The Kid from Brooklyn (1946)
Where There’s Life (1947)
The Paleface (1948)
It’s a Great Feeling (1949)
Sorrowful Jones (1949)
The Great Lover (1949)
Riding High (1950)
The Daughter of Rosie O’Grady (1950)
Double Dynamite (1951)
I’ll See You in My Dreams (1951)
On Moonlight Bay (1951)
April in Paris (1952)
Room for One More (1952)
Trouble Along the Way (1953)
Living It Up (1954)
The Seven Little Foys (1955)
Beau James (1957)
Houseboat (1958)
The Five Pennies (1959)
It Started in Naples (1960)
On the Double (1961)
The Pigeon That Took Rome (1962)
A New Kind of Love (1963)
Yours, Mine and Ours (1968)
The War Between Men and Women (1972)
Yours, Mine and Ours (2005)
The Film Director
Melville Shavelson directed the following films:The Seven Little Foys (1955)
Beau James (1957)
Houseboat (1958)
The Five Pennies (1959)
It Started in Naples (1960)
On the Double (1961)
The Pigeon That Took Rome (1962)
A New Kind of Love (1963)
Cast a Giant Shadow (1966)
Yours, Mine and Ours (1968)
The War Between Men and Women (1972)
